A beggar sat on the sidewalk, in a place where many people passed and placed a sign with the following words:

"Look how happy I am! I am a prosperous man, I know I am handsome, I am very important, I have a beautiful residence, I live comfortably, I am successful, I am healthy and in a good mood."

Some passers-by seemed puzzled, others thought he was crazy, and others even gave him money.
Every day, before going to sleep, he counted the money and noticed that each day the amount was greater. One beautiful morning, a bold and important executive, who had been watching him for some time, came up to him and said:

"You are very creative! Wouldn't you like to collaborate on a company campaign?"
"Come on. I can only win!" Replied the beggar. "

After a good shower and new clothes, he went to the company.

From then on, his life was a series of successes and at some point he became one of the majority partners. At a press conference, he explained how he managed to leave begging and reach such a high position.

He said:

Well, there was a time when I used to sit on the sidewalks with a sign next to it, which said:

"I am nothing in this world! No one helps me! I have nowhere to live! I am a failed and abused man for life! I cannot get a miserable job that earns me a few dollars! I can barely survive! "

Things went from bad to worse when, one night, I found a book and an excerpt that said:

"Everything that talks about you is reinforced. As bad as your life is, say that everything is going well. As much as you don't like your appearance, affirm yourself beautiful. As poor as you are, tell yourself and others that they are prosperous".

I was deeply moved and since I had nothing to lose, I decided to change the words on the sign to:

"Look how happy I am! I am a prosperous man, I know I am handsome, I am very important, I have a beautiful residence, I live comfortably, I am successful, I am healthy and in a good mood."

And from that day everything began to change, life brought me the right person for everything I needed, until I got to where I am today. I just had to understand the power of words.

The Universe always supports everything we say, write or think about ourselves and this will end up manifesting itself in our lives as a reality.

While we say that everything is going wrong, that our appearance is horrible, that our material goods are small, the tendency is for things to get even worse, because words have power. All our beliefs in our lives materialize.

"Death and life are in the power of the tongue: and those who love it will eat its fruit" (Proverbs 18:21).
